is DISPOSITION OF WASTEWATER <br /> The 70 gallons of wastewater that were generated from purging of the monitor wells and <br /> decontamination of the purging and sampling equipment were transported via a non <br /> hazardous waste manifest to Instrat, Inc , a licensed recycling facility <br /> GROUNDWATER GRADIENT AND FLOW DIRECTION <br /> Figure 4 shows the groundwater elevation giadient and flow direction determined from <br /> depth to water measurements at the four on-site monitor wells on December 6, 2004 The <br /> gioundwater elevation has decreased by an average of 0 4 feet since the previous <br /> quarterly monitoring round on September 29, 2004 The flow direction is to the <br /> East/Northeast The overall gradient is 0 002 feet/linear foot <br /> RESULTS OF CERTIFIED ANALYSIS OF GROUNDWATER SAMPLES <br /> The results of the certified analyses of groundwater samples collected from the four <br /> monitor wells on December 6, 2004 are shown in Table 1 Copies of the laboratory <br /> reports are included as Appendix C of this report <br /> TPH-G concentrations in MWI-MW3 ranged from a maximum of 5,700 ug/l at monitor <br /> well MWI to 1400 ug/1 at monitor well MW2 TPH-G was not detected in monitor well <br /> MW-9A that is located approximately 60 feet east of MW3 and associated with the <br /> . neighboring property at 1201 S Center (see Figure 5) Monitor well MW4, completed in <br /> a lower aquifer, showed a TPH-G concentration of 170 ug/l <br /> Benzene concentrations in MWI-MW3 ranged from a maximum of 1900 ug/I at MWI to <br /> 280 ug/l at MW2 Monitor well MW4 showed a Benzene concentration of<0 5 ug/l <br /> MTBE concentrations in MWI-MW3 ranged from a maximum of 29 ug/I at MW3 to 3 4 <br /> ug/1 at MW2 MTBE was not detected above 0 5 ug/1 in MW4 <br /> TBA concentrations in MWI-MW3 ranged from a maximum of 18 ug/L in MW3 to 7 6 <br /> ug/L in MW2 TBA was not detected above the laboratory limit of 0 5 ug/L in MW4 <br /> The remaining fuel oxygenants, ETBE, DIPE, and TAME were not found above the <br /> laboratory detection limits in any of the four monitor wells <br /> The lead scavenger 1,2 Dichloroetbane (DCA) was detected in a concentration of 2 4 <br /> ug/L in MW2 and MW3 DCA was not detected above the laboratory limit of 0 5 ug/L in <br /> MWI or MW4 1,2 Dibromoethane (DBA or EDB) was not found in any of the monitor <br /> wells above the laboratory detection limit of 0 5 ug/L <br /> Figure 5 shows the distribution of TPH-G, BTEX, and MTBE in groundwater and the <br /> estimated lateral limits of the TPH-G in groundwater as determined from groundwater <br /> samples collected on December 6, 2004 <br /> 3 Arc Pump QM 10-12, 2004 <br />
